Welcome to a new Tic-Tac-Toe challenge at Retro Rubber. Simply choose a row, line or diagonal and make sure your creation uses all three features. Easy! Of course, since this is Retro Rubber the requirement to use at least one stamp a year or more old AND to indicate the age of it still stands.


I like a good tic-tac-toe challenge and especially this one, since Jane gave me the job of creating it! So I really hope you enjoy playing it too.

I played the diagonal line: birthday - die or punch - patterned paper.
This was a challenge for me as I seldom use DSP in my card making. I've used it in two ways: both as a background paper and to paper piece some parts of the foliage.


I've paired up Perennial Birthday, from the 2018 Occasions catalogue, with some of the lovely Magnolia Lane DSP from the 2019 catalogue. I like that using old favourites with new products gives them a new lease of life and a new look.


I've used both a die - Stitched Rectangles - and the Leaf punch.
